-
下载mysql解压版本,这里用的是5.7.19,下载完成后直接解压,我的安装目录为D:\2021\soft\mysql-5.7.19
-
添加环境变量,再path后添加D:\2021\soft\mysql-5.7.19\bin
-
编辑 my.ini 文件,注意是 “/” \可能后面初始化失败
[mysqld]
basedir=D:/2021/soft/mysql-5.7.19/
datadir=D:/2021/soft/mysql-5.7.19/data/
port=3306
#skip-grant-tables -
管理员模式启动cmd,并将路径切换至mysql下的bin目录,然后输入mysqld –install(安装mysql)
这里可能出现由于找不到msvcr120.dll无法继续执行代码的报错,有两种方案解决:
a.下载安装Microsoft Visual C++ 2012(VC2012运行库)
微软官网下载:https://www.microsoft.com/zh-CN/download/details.aspx?id=30679b.安装vcredist_x64.exe还是报错,可以下载DirectXRepair39使用解决
-
mysqld --initialize-insecure --user=mysql 初始化数据文件
-
net start mysql启动服务
-
mysql –u root –p 进入mysql管理界面(密码可为空)
-
修改密码
update mysql.user set authentication_string=password('123456') where user='root' and Host = 'localhost';
- flush privileges;刷新权限
- 重启mysql即可正常使用
net stop mysql
net start mysql
附注用到的工具下载链接
链接:https://pan.baidu.com/s/1XGUxQerVky6bEag-m2NRBw
提取码:h5r0